Why a Ladder Tree Stand Support Bar Is Necessary
From my experience, a ladder tree stand support bar is one of the most important parts of the setup because it adds extra stability. When I’m climbing up or sitting in the stand, I want to feel secure, and the support bar helps reduce unwanted movement and wobbling. That extra support gives me more confidence, especially when the stand is placed on uneven ground or against a tree that isn’t perfectly straight.
I also consider the support bar necessary because it improves safety during both setup and use. A ladder stand can shift if it is not properly braced, and that can create a serious risk. With the support bar in place, I feel like the stand is better anchored, which lowers the chance of slipping or tipping while I’m climbing or adjusting my position.
Another reason I rely on it is comfort. When my stand feels solid, I can focus more on the hunt and less on balancing myself. That stability makes a big difference during long sits, because even small movements can become tiring or distracting over time. For me, the support bar is not just an extra accessory—it is a key part of making the stand safer, steadier, and more dependable.
My Buying Guides on Ladder Tree Stand Support Bar
What I Look for First
When I shop for a ladder tree stand support bar, my first priority is safety. I want a bar that helps keep the stand steady, reduces movement, and gives me more confidence while climbing and hunting. I also make sure it matches the type of ladder stand I already own, because not every support bar fits every model.
Compatibility with My Tree Stand
One of the first things I check is whether the support bar is compatible with my ladder tree stand. I look at the brand, model, and mounting style before buying. If the bar does not fit properly, it can create more problems than it solves. I always prefer a product that clearly lists the stand types it works with.
Strength and Durability
I pay close attention to the material and construction. A support bar should be made from strong steel or another durable material that can handle outdoor use and repeated pressure. Since I use mine in different weather conditions, I want something that resists rust and wear over time.
Stability and Support
For me, the main purpose of a support bar is to improve stability. I look for a design that reduces wobbling and helps distribute weight more evenly. A solid support bar gives me more peace of mind when I am climbing up or settling into the stand.
Ease of Installation
I prefer a support bar that is easy to install without complicated tools or extra parts. If I can set it up quickly and securely, that saves me time and frustration. Clear instructions are important to me, especially when I am preparing for a hunting trip and want everything ready fast.
Weight and Portability
Since I often carry and assemble my gear in the field, I think about weight too. I want a support bar that is sturdy but not overly heavy. A good balance between strength and portability makes it easier for me to transport and handle during setup.
Weather Resistance
Because my gear stays outdoors a lot, I always consider weather resistance. I look for a support bar with a protective coating or finish that can stand up to rain, snow, and humidity. This helps me get more use out of it and protects my investment.
Price and Value
I do not always go for the cheapest option. Instead, I look for the best value. If a support bar costs a little more but offers better safety, durability, and fit, I think it is worth it. For me, a reliable product is more important than saving a few dollars.
Customer Reviews and Ratings
Before I make my final decision, I read customer reviews. I want to know how the support bar performs in real use, not just in the product description. Reviews help me learn about installation issues, durability, and whether other buyers felt it improved their stand’s stability.
